Boss types

Analytical Boss


Public Profiles:
Mark Zuckerberg or Bill Gates.


How to Spot One:
They love numbers and making decisions based on solid facts. They’re careful and don’t like taking risks without good reason.


What to Do:
Focus on the risks of not following your suggestion and back it up with lots of data. They need to see the logic behind your ideas.

Driver Boss


Public Profiles:
Steve Jobs

How to Spot One:
They make quick decisions, often based on just a bit of information. They’re always in a hurry and want to see progress.


What to Do:
Give them options so they feel in control. Be direct and to the point, showing how your choice speeds up results or improves efficiency.

Expressive Boss


Public Profiles:
Richard Branson

How to Spot One:
They’re the life of the party, full of energy, and always looking for the next big thing. They might jump from one idea to another.

What to Do:
Keep your ideas exciting and visionary. Don’t bog them down with too many details; focus on the big, inspiring picture.

Amiable Boss


Public Profiles:
Albus Dumbledore from Harry Potter

How to Spot One:
They’re very people-focused, avoid conflict, and always want to make sure everyone is happy and safe.


What to Do:
Use success stories and case studies to show your idea is safe and has worked before. They need to know your plan will keep everyone content and secure.W
